Output 9d6323e5644da10d3b37068892545a7b08505831a97fce989843d7af4a72dad7:0

value
12957317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4994b22ea2c3a15e27a161acaeb81531f3518dd8 OP_EQUAL
address
MEcDh1ofX9RTABhKC2Ew1s72TiYYenLo6P
transaction
9d6323e5644da10d3b37068892545a7b08505831a97fce989843d7af4a72dad7
spent
true